 * Hello,
    I am trying to use Elegant Theme’s “Envisioned” theme as a parent theme
   for a client’s site with Posts 2 Posts. I have a starter theme that I usually
   use as the basis for projects (a code base of sorts). When I learned of the Posts
   2 Posts plugin, I tried it in my starter theme and everything worked as expected,
   so I intended to use it for this project. The P2P plugin, when used with the 
   Envisioned theme works normally. When I try to use it with my child theme, the
   plugins page (only) displays the white screen of death (other admin pages are
   fine). The culprit appeared to be in the functions file of the child theme, so
   I commented out all functions and reintroduced them one by one. I was able to
   narrow it down to the function that I use to display subpages and my employee
   custom post type (require_once). What’s strange is that these lines of code are
   identical to my starter theme’s function file. Even stranger, I moved two functions
   below the subpages function within the child theme’s functions file to make it
   exactly the same as the starter theme. Then I followed a similar comment/uncomment
   testing scenario and found that I was able to get it to work with subpage function
   uncommented but with the require_once for the employee post type and the require_once
   for the file that creates a “global info” (tagline, phone #, etc) options page
   in the admin commented out. I was able to keep the options page require_once 
   uncommented before. This leads me to believe that it’s not the exact code that’s
   creating the issue. Unfortunately, it also leaves me not having a clue of what
   the problem is. I am writing Elegant themes too, but I was hoping that someone
   might have some insight into this issue. Thanks. -Steph

 * > When I try to use it with my child theme, the plugins page (only) displays 
   > the white screen of death (other admin pages are fine).
 * So, you mean `wp-admin/plugins.php`, right?
 * Add `define( 'WP_DEBUG', true );` to your wp-config.php file. You should see 
   a “Fatal error:” message instead of a WSOD.

 * You really need to get a hold of that fatal error.
 * A) Look for error log files
    B) Add [this file](https://gist.github.com/625769)
   in your `wp-content/mu-plugins` directory (create the dir if it’s not there).

 * So I was able to get an error for a separate plugin that is not in the starter
   theme files. It was a memory limit error for the Admin Menu Tree Page View plugin.
   So I disabled it and everything seemed to work fine thereafter. I know the memory
   limit error is an issue with the server configuration, and I was working on MAMP(
   local server) while making the child theme…since re-uploading the site to our
   demo server, I’ve been able to reactivate the Admin Menu Tree Page View plugin
   and haven’t encountered a nasty WSOD yet. Let’s hope that was it.
